Date: Sun, 8 Oct 2000 23:08:01 -0700 (PDT) From: Kris Kennaway <kris@FreeBSD.org> To: cvs-committers@FreeBSD.org, cvs-all@FreeBSD.org Subject: cvs commit: src/usr.sbin/mrouted cfparse.y main.c mtrace.c prune.c Message-ID: <200010090608.XAA93040@freefall.freebsd.org>
next in thread | raw e-mail | index | archive | help
kris 2000/10/08 23:08:01 PDT Modified files: usr.sbin/mrouted cfparse.y main.c mtrace.c prune.c Log: String buffer safety cleanup. I don't think any of these were exploitable remotely, but they would be if e.g. it happened to call the logging function using a DNS hostname. Also replace random() by arc4random() - only one of these is arguably required since it's directly used in the protocol, but we might as well replace both to avoid using two different PRNGs. Reviewed by: green, alex Revision Changes Path 1.11 +5 -5 src/usr.sbin/mrouted/cfparse.y 1.18 +3 -5 src/usr.sbin/mrouted/main.c 1.19 +2 -4 src/usr.sbin/mrouted/mtrace.c 1.18 +2 -2 src/usr.sbin/mrouted/prune.c To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e cvs-all" in the body of the message
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200010090608.XAA93040>